Sedation dentistry

Sedation dentistry is a method of dentistry that may involve medication being administered in order to help the patient relax during their appointment. There are a few different methods of sedation dentistry that exist. Patients can work with their dentists to determine which method might be best for them.

Laughing gas

One method of oral sedation that patients can opt for is that of laughing gas. This is a method of minimal sedation. But, it does do enough to help reduce anxiety during the dental appointment.

Laughing gas is just nitrous oxide which is inhaled through a mask. The patient should be relaxed enough to have an anxiety-free appointment without the heavy grogginess afterward. Laughing gas can be used for any type of dental appointment because it is not too heavy. Also, the effects do not tend to linger for long.

Medications

Some oral sedation methods, such as medications, are used in sedation dentistry for more serious procedures or for patients who have higher amounts of anxiety. These medications are typically administered an hour or so before the appointment. This is in order to give it time to take effect.

When medications are used in sedation dentistry, it can really provide a relaxing environment for the patient. Medications may make the patient fall asleep which would provide an anxiety-free appointment. However, these medications do tend to have lingering effects.

General anesthesia

Another common way that people can relax is through the use of general anesthesia. But this method is typically only given for serious or invasive procedures. Patients that have extreme anxiety can talk with their dentists about being put under general anesthesia for procedures that really scare them.

With general anesthesia, the patient becomes unconscious. This is so dental work can be done while they are not aware of their surroundings. Being put under general anesthesia can allow for the most anxiety-free type of dental appointment. This is because the patient is unconscious and is not able to experience those fears or uneasiness.
